The Fresh Tomato Basil Caprese is a timeless Italian salad that embodies the vibrant tastes of summer. With its simple combination of ripe tomatoes, fresh mozzarella, fragrant basil, and a drizzle of olive oil, it captures the essence of Italian cooking. This classic dish is perfect as an appetizer or a light meal and is incredibly easy to prepare.

Ingredients

  • 4 large ripe tomatoes, sliced
  • 12 ounces fresh mozzarella, sliced
  • 1 bunch fresh basil leaves
  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 tablespoon balsamic glaze (optional)
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ste

Cooking method

  1. Prepare the Ingredients: Begin by slicing the tomatoes and fresh mozzarella into approximately 1/4 inch thick slices. Wash the basil leaves and pat them dry.

  2. Assemble the Salad: On a large plate or platter, arrange the tomato and mozzarella slices in an alternating pattern. Place a basil leaf between each slice for a visually appealing presentation.

  3. Seasoning: Drizzle the olive oil evenly over the salad. If desired, you can also add a light drizzle of balsamic glaze for a touch of sweetness. Sprinkle with sal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ste.

  4. Serve: The Fresh Tomato Basil Caprese is best enjoyed immediately, while the flavors are at their peak.

Nutritious Value and Pairings

The Fresh Tomato Basil Caprese is not only a delight to the taste buds but also a nutritious choice. Tomatoes are a rich source of antioxidants like lycopene, which have been linked to numerous health benefits, including reduced risk of heart disease and cancer. Mozzarella provides a good source of protein and calcium, essential for bone health. Basil adds a burst of flavor without adding calories, and olive oil is packed with heart-healthy monounsaturated fats.

To round out your meal, consider pairing this dish with a side of crusty bread to soak up the juices. For those looking for a more substantial meal, it pairs beautifully with a grilled chicken breast or a serving of prosciutto. As for drinks, a crisp white wine such as Pinot Grigio or a refreshing glass of iced tea would complement the fresh flavors perfectly. Alternatively, a sparkling water with a slice of lemon or lime can serve as a refreshing non-alcoholic option.
